    Retired U.S. Army Gen. David H. Petraeus points to a U.S. Army 101st Airborne Division (Air Assault) patch worn by North Dakota National Guard Soldier Sgt. 1st Class Chris Dietz, of Mandan, N.D., on April 29, 2014, at the Raymond J. Bohn Armory in Bismarck, N.D. Petraeus commanded the 101st Airborne Division in 2003 during the beginning of Operation Iraqi Freedom, and Dietz wears the patch on his right shoulder signifying his service with the division during his deployment to Iraq with the North Dakota National Guard.
